Transaction 34dd201e6d821486589f45891c14661569e978bb9a1c6bcb0e1bb3ea01218791

1 Input
2 Outputs
  • 34dd201e6d821486589f45891c14661569e978bb9a1c6bcb0e1bb3ea01218791:0
  • value  1278637
    address  3FLCVW24JruM8UsBzEtXsNxCrGaumcQxYi
  • 34dd201e6d821486589f45891c14661569e978bb9a1c6bcb0e1bb3ea01218791:1
  • value  1322272
    address  3CW6YWzjXn43yT7NSyhEZSFwqpvsNDsmXq